Dragon Tattoo Sequel Moving Forward

Sony’s The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o, which cost about $90 million to make (not counting marketing costs), has earned $60 million at the domestic box office and will still be hitting many international territories in January. So, while some are saying it’s underperforming, it’s no surprise that the studio is moving forward with plans to make the sequel, The Girl Who Played with Fire.

?[Dragon Tattoo] continues to do strong business and nothing has changed with respect to development of the next book,? a Sony rep told Entertainment Weekly. “Development continues? on the sequel and Steven Zaillian is still working on the script as planned.

It is unclear whether David Fincher will return to direct at this point, but Rooney Mara and Daniel Craig are both signed for the other two films.
